Setting the Light Sensitivity

This allows the sensitivity to light (ISO sensitivity) to be set. Setting to a higher figure

enables pictures to be taken even in dark places without the resulting pictures coming out

dark.

ISO sensitivity Settings
AUTO¢
maximum [ISO800] The ISO sensitivity is automatically adjusted according to the
brightness.
¢
(Intelligent)
maximum [ISO800]
The ISO sensitivity is adjusted according to the movement of
the subject and the brightness.
160/200/400/800/1600/3200/
6400
The ISO sensitivity is fixed to various settings.
